What are the dark-colored vegetables

There is a wide variety of dark-colored vegetables, broadly categorized into dark green vegetables, red vegetables, purple vegetables, etc., such as spinach, rapeseed, celery leaves, water spinach, mustard greens, broccoli, wormwood, scallions, radish greens, tomatoes, carrots, pumpkins, red peppers, and red cabbage. Compared to light-colored vegetables, they contain more vitamin C, carotenoids, and anthocyanins.

1. Red Vegetables

The most common red vegetables are tomatoes and carrots, as well as red amaranth, red rapeseed, and red peppers. These foods are rich in lycopene and carotenoids, and it is suitable to eat them after heating to better absorb the nutrients.

2. Purple Vegetables

Purple vegetables like eggplants, red cabbage, and purple asparagus are characterized by high content of anthocyanins, which have antioxidant properties, can prolong life, and help protect cardiovascular health. 3. Dark Green Vegetables

There are also many types of dark green vegetables, such as spinach, rapeseed, wormwood, and oil麦菜 used for hotpot in autumn and winter. These vegetables are important sources of vitamin B2, folic acid, and vitamin K, and they can also provide certain minerals like potassium, calcium, phosphorus, and magnesium.
